Ingredients
The magic of this bowl lies in the marriage of fresh, vibrant ingredients. Tender chicken thighs soak up a robust taco‑seasoning blend, while the rice is infused with cilantro, lime zest, and a hint of garlic. The chipotle‑lime sauce adds depth and a gentle heat, and the toppings—avocado, corn, and pickled red onion—bring texture and brightness. Together they create a balanced, satisfying dish that feels both indulgent and wholesome.
Main Ingredients
- 1 lb boneless, skinless chicken thighs
- 1 cup long‑grain white rice
- 2 cups water or low‑sodium chicken broth
- 1 avocado, sliced
- ½ cup frozen corn kernels, thawed
Sauce / Marinade
- 2 tablespoons chipotle in adobo sauce, minced
- 1 tablespoon lime juice (about ½ lime)
- 1 teaspoon honey or agave
- 1 clove garlic, minced
Seasonings & Garnishes
- 1 tablespoon taco seasoning blend
- ¼ cup fresh cilantro, chopped
- Zest of 1 lime
- ½ red onion, thinly sliced and pickled
- Salt and freshly ground black pepper, to taste

Step-by-Step Instructions
Preparing the Marinade & Chicken
In a medium bowl, combine taco seasoning, chipotle in adobo, lime juice, honey, and minced garlic. Whisk until smooth, then toss the chicken thighs until fully coated. Let the mixture rest for at least 10 minutes; this short marination allows the flavors to penetrate the meat, ensuring every bite is seasoned.
Cooking the Chicken
- Heat the Skillet. Place a large non‑stick skillet over medium‑high heat and add 1 tablespoon olive oil. When the oil shimmers (about 30 seconds), it’s hot enough for a quick sear.
- Sear the Chicken. Lay the marinated thighs in the skillet, leaving space between pieces. Cook 4–5 minutes without moving them; this creates a caramelized crust. Flip and sear the other side for another 4–5 minutes.
- Finish in the Oven. Reduce heat to medium, then transfer the skillet to a preheated 375°F (190°C) oven. B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the internal temperature reaches 165°F (74°C). Rest the chicken for 5 minutes before slicing.
Cooking the Cilantro‑Lime Rice
Rinse the rice under cold water until the water runs clear. In a saucepan, combine the rice, water or broth, a pinch of salt, and a drizzle of olive oil. Bring to a boil, then cover and reduce to low heat for 15 minutes. Remove from heat, let sit covered for 5 minutes, then fluff with a fork. Stir in cilantro, lime zest, and a squeeze of fresh lime juice for brightness.
Assembling the Fiesta Bowl
Divide the cilantro‑lime rice among four bowls. Top each with sliced chicken, a handful of corn kernels, avocado slices, and pickled red onion. Drizzle the remaining chipotle‑lime sauce over everything, then garnish with extra cilantro and a final lime wedge. Serve immediately while the chicken is warm and the sauce is glossy.
Tips & Tricks
Perfecting the Recipe
Room‑Temp Chicken: Let the thighs sit out for 10‑15 minutes before cooking. Even temperature ensures uniform browning and prevents a raw center.
Pat Dry Before Searing: Moisture hinders caramelization. Dab the chicken with paper towels after marinating to achieve a crisp crust.
Use a Heavy Skillet: Cast iron or stainless steel retains heat better, giving a deeper sear and richer flavor.
Rest the Meat: Allow the chicken to rest 5 minutes after baking. This redistributes juices, keeping each slice moist.
Flavor Enhancements
Finish the sauce with a splash of orange juice for a subtle citrus lift, or stir in a tablespoon of Greek yogurt for creamy richness. A pinch of smoked paprika adds an extra layer of smokiness without extra heat.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Skipping the resting step will cause the chicken to release its juices onto the plate, leaving the meat dry. Also, avoid cooking on too high a flame; the exterior can char before the interior reaches safe temperature.
Pro Tips
Toast the Rice First: Lightly toasting the rice in a dry pan for 2 minutes adds a nutty depth before simmering.
Make Extra Sauce: Double the chipotle‑lime sauce and store in a small jar; it’s perfect for drizzling over leftovers or tacos later.
Use a Meat Thermometer: Aim for 165°F (74°C) for poultry. This eliminates guesswork and guarantees safety.
Finish with Fresh Herbs: A handful of chopped cilantro added just before serving preserves its bright flavor and aroma.
Variations
Ingredient Swaps
Replace chicken with grilled shrimp, thinly sliced flank steak, or firm tofu for a vegetarian spin. Swap white rice for brown rice, quinoa, or cauliflower rice to change the texture and nutritional profile. Try roasted sweet‑potato cubes instead of corn for added sweetness.
Dietary Adjustments
For gluten‑free meals, ensure the taco seasoning is certified gluten‑free and use tamari in place of soy‑based sauces. To make it dairy‑free, keep the recipe as is—no dairy is required. For a low‑carb/keto version, serve the chicken over a bed of shredded cabbage or zucchini ribbons.
Serving Suggestions
Pair the bowl with a side of black‑bean salsa, a simple lime‑yogurt dip, or a crisp cucumber‑tomato salad. For extra indulgence, crumble a bit of queso fresco on top or serve with warm corn tortillas on the side.
Storage Info
Leftover Storage
Allow the bowl to cool to room temperature, then transfer the rice, chicken, and toppings into separate airtight containers. Store in the refrigerator for 3‑4 days. For longer keeping, portion the chicken and sauce into freezer‑safe bags and freeze for up to 3 months; label with the date.
Reheating Instructions
Reheat the chicken and rice in a 350°F (175°C) oven, covered with foil, for 12‑15 minutes or until steaming hot. Alternatively, microwave the chicken and rice together with a splash of broth for 2‑3 minutes, stirring halfway. Add a fresh drizzle of chipotle‑lime sauce after reheating to revive the bright flavors.
